Output ebc4c332b578b8e5ec622222c0957a837b58998f5154b33fa59df4d7b4c7a359:0

value
150000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f45932d27bd2194d1016b4c456203102f35697cec56ca453e518b8f9fd1ad892
address
tb1p73vn95nm6gv56yqkknz9vgp3qte4d97wc4k2g5l9rzu0nlg6mzfq4ke6x9
transaction
ebc4c332b578b8e5ec622222c0957a837b58998f5154b33fa59df4d7b4c7a359
confirmations
53638
spent
true